Understanding the Foundations: Essential Skills for Success
To excel in the field of cybersecurity and make the most of the Global Certificate in Identifying Vulnerabilities and Threats, it's crucial to possess a combination of technical, analytical, and communication skills. Technical skills, such as proficiency in operating systems, networking protocols, and security frameworks, form the foundation of a cybersecurity professional's toolkit. Analytical skills, including the ability to analyze complex data sets and identify patterns, are also vital in identifying vulnerabilities and threats. Furthermore, effective communication skills are necessary to convey complex technical information to non-technical stakeholders, ensuring that security measures are implemented and maintained across the organization. By focusing on these essential skills, professionals can set themselves up for success in the cybersecurity field and make a meaningful impact in their organizations.
Implementing Best Practices: A Proactive Approach to Cybersecurity
The Global Certificate in Identifying Vulnerabilities and Threats emphasizes the importance of implementing best practices in cybersecurity. This includes conducting regular vulnerability assessments, penetration testing, and security audits to identify potential weaknesses in an organization's systems and infrastructure. It's also essential to stay up-to-date with the latest security patches, updates, and threat intelligence to ensure that defenses are current and effective. By adopting a proactive approach to cybersecurity, organizations can reduce the risk of cyberattacks and minimize the impact of breaches when they do occur.
